Environmental Impact of the Brother Inkvestment Mfc-J995Dw in 2026
The environmental footprint of the Brother Inkvestment Mfc-J995Dw involves several factors, including energy consumption, ink cartridge usage, and manufacturing processes. The device is designed with energy efficiency in mind, complying with modern standards such as ENERGY STAR certification, which helps reduce electricity use during operation.
However, like all electronic devices, it consumes power even in standby mode. Manufacturers have made strides to minimize this impact, but users can further reduce their environmental footprint by unplugging the device when not in use and utilizing energy-saving settings.
Recycling Options for the Brother Inkvestment Mfc-J995Dw in 2026
Recycling is a vital aspect of reducing electronic waste. Brother offers several options for recycling the Mfc-J995Dw and its consumables in 2026:
- Official Recycling Program: Brother’s dedicated recycling program allows users to return used cartridges and the printer itself for proper disposal and recycling. Participants often receive incentives or discounts on future purchases.
- Local Recycling Centers: Many communities have e-waste recycling centers that accept printers and cartridges. It is recommended to contact local facilities to confirm acceptance and procedures.
- Retail Drop-Off: Some electronics retailers partner with manufacturers to provide in-store recycling options. Check with local stores for availability.
To ensure environmentally responsible disposal, always follow manufacturer instructions and local regulations. Proper recycling prevents hazardous materials from polluting the environment and promotes the reuse of valuable materials like plastics and metals.
